Building a Data Management Strategy

As your business accumulates more data, it must to be stored in a manner that is smart and scalable, as well as secure. This process is called data management. It may be overwhelming to begin constructing your data strategy, but the best method begins by determining what your company’s goals are from this effort.

For example, a business that wants to use its data to enhance customer relationships will require different requirements for managing data than a company which is focused on enhancing sales opportunities. Based on this understanding your team can develop a plan that is tailored to the unique goals of your company.

Data management also entails creating and making processes that https://www.reproworthy.com/business/virtual-data-storage-is-it-time-for-your-company-to-switch-to-the-cloud/ can be repeated. This allows your team’s usage of data to increase and maintain the quality of data without the necessity of running the same queries manually over and over.

A solid data management strategy should include creating and maintaining security protocols to ensure your personal data is safe from hackers and other external threats. It could include encryption tools and authentication tools that aid in making your business comply to federal regulations on privacy of consumers.

Data management is about storing and organizing your company’s valuable data but the real value is when you use that information to make better decisions. Data management practices can serve as an intelligence foundation that reduces costs and improve customer relationships. It can also drive more revenue. However, only if the information is current and accurate. A flawed piece of data can damage your bottom line and destroy the trust of your customers.
